How do affirmations reach subconscious best?
If we just intellectually repeat affirmations, from what I experienced and read about other people experiences, it takes 1-2 years of daily "drilling" until significant results can be reached, and most of us give up before that time.
But there are ways to reach it faster and easier. I am experimenting with 2 ways now, and both involve affirmations I recorded in my own voice.
1.) I use them in audible sound, but listen to them, when I am in hypnosis like state (falling asleep or waking up, sleepy, and I would use, when I am sick, but for now I felt great, so didn't get to use that ). I simply played music on low sound as I recorded, but now I could connect it with the same program I used for subliminal recording.
2.) Made subliminal recording by putting voice file on very low volume comparing to music or nawww.MC2Method.org/subliminal-software/ture sounds.

Those are good methods. The trick is to get emotionally involved in the affirmation.
Your subconscious doesn't think, it just responds to what is notable or intense. So the more emotion we put behind something the more likely it will be internalized by the subconscious.
I think you can speed the affirmation recordings effects up by getting in a positively charged state from time to time while listening to them and getting consciously involved with them, in addition to just letting them play in the background.
The subconscious takes note of repeated things but emotional things trump that.

You could use a cleaning analogy. Say we have a cruddy pan and a scrubber. The scrubber represents our affirmations, the cruddy pan represents us. Getting a clean pan represents our desired internal change.
You can simply repeat moving the scrubber back and forth peacefully and that will eventually get you a clean pan - after several hours.
Or you can put your back into it and scrub living daylights out of that pan til it shines like a diamond - in a few minutes or less.
The effort put into it represents the emotion you back your affirmations with. More positive emotion = quicker results.
So when you say your affirmation, don't just say it like you're reading it. Really put feeling into. Pretend that your an actor and you're reciting the biggest lines of your life. Feel it.
Do this verbally, in real time, to yourself; and you can record it too and listen passively. Passive listening will also benefit from the emotional punch.
No emotion will work too, but if you want results quick, put your back into it.
